Output 36f4b31708ec408b6ca44c34f60b4f503c9f430899f5554e64b26d77e21a6773:1

value
6968485729076
script pubkey
OP_0 OP_PUSHBYTES_20 62beb2f9e7cc4f93a0f4cd30ad1e5ab06cf160ab
address
tb1qv2lt9708e38e8g85e5c268j6kpk0zc9tjsnu6d
transaction
36f4b31708ec408b6ca44c34f60b4f503c9f430899f5554e64b26d77e21a6773
spent
true